「コピーライト更新年を自動反映!JavaScriptやサーバーサイドで効率化」

ウェブサイトのコピーライト更新年を手動で変更する作業は、管理者にとって時間と労力がかかる課題です。この記事では、JavaScriptサーバーサイド言語を使用して、コピーライトの更新年を自動的に反映させる方法を紹介します。これにより、管理者の負担を軽減し、ウェブサイトの品質向上を図ることができます。

自動反映の仕組みを導入することで、時間的コストの削減人的ミスの軽減、さらには情報セキュリティーの向上といったメリットが得られます。また、実際に大手企業やeコマースサイトで採用されている事例も取り上げ、その効果を検証します。将来的には、AIクラウドサービスとの統合によるさらなる自動化が期待されています。

この記事を通じて、コピーライト更新年の自動化がもたらす効率化と、その実装方法について理解を深めていただければ幸いです。

📖 目次
  1. イントロダクション
  2. コピーライト更新年の課題
  3. JavaScriptを使った自動反映方法
  4. サーバーサイド言語を使った自動反映方法
  5. 自動反映のメリット
  6. 実例紹介:大手企業やeコマースサイト
  7. 今後の展望:AIやクラウドサービスの活用
  8. まとめ
  9. よくある質問
    1. 1. コピーライト更新年を自動反映するメリットは何ですか?
    2. 2. JavaScriptでコピーライト年を自動更新する方法は?
    3. 3. サーバーサイドでコピーライト年を自動更新する場合の注意点は?
    4. 4. コピーライト年を自動更新する際のベストプラクティスは?

イントロダクション

ウェブサイトのコピーライト更新年を手動で変更する作業は、管理者にとって時間と労力がかかる課題です。特に、複数のページを持つ大規模なサイトでは、更新漏れやミスが発生しやすくなります。そこで、JavaScriptサーバーサイド言語を活用して、コピーライトの更新年を自動的に反映させる方法が注目されています。これにより、管理者の負担を軽減しつつ、ウェブサイトの品質向上を図ることが可能です。

自動反映の仕組みを導入することで、時間的コストの削減人的ミスの防止が実現されます。さらに、最新の情報を常に提供できるため、ユーザーに対する信頼性も向上します。特に、大手企業eコマースサイトでは、このような自動化が既に導入されており、その効果が実証されています。将来的には、AIクラウドサービスとの連携によって、さらに高度な自動化が進むことが期待されています。

コピーライト更新年の課題

ウェブサイト運営において、コピーライト更新年の管理は重要な課題の一つです。特に、複数のページを持つ大規模なサイトでは、毎年手動で更新するのは時間と労力がかかります。さらに、更新漏れが発生すると、法的リスクやユーザーからの信頼低下につながる可能性もあります。このような課題を解決するため、自動化技術の導入が注目されています。

JavaScriptサーバーサイド言語を活用することで、コピーライト更新年を自動的に反映させることが可能です。これにより、管理者の負担が軽減されるだけでなく、人的ミスのリスクも大幅に削減されます。特に、JavaScriptを使用したクライアントサイドでの実装は、比較的簡単に導入できるため、中小規模のサイトでも効果的です。一方、サーバーサイドでの実装は、より高度なカスタマイズやセキュリティ対策が可能で、大規模なサイトやeコマースプラットフォームに適しています。

自動化の導入により、時間的コストの削減や情報セキュリティの向上が期待できます。さらに、将来的にはAIクラウドサービスとの連携により、より高度な自動化が実現されるでしょう。これにより、ウェブサイト運営の効率化がさらに進み、管理者はより重要な業務に集中できるようになります。

JavaScriptを使った自動反映方法

JavaScriptを使った自動反映方法は、クライアントサイドで簡単に実装できるため、多くのウェブサイトで採用されています。具体的には、Dateオブジェクトを使用して現在の年を取得し、それをコピーライト表示部分に動的に反映させます。この方法は、ブラウザ上で直接実行されるため、サーバー側の処理を必要とせず、即座に反映される点が大きなメリットです。また、コードの記述もシンプルで、初心者でも比較的簡単に実装できます。

例えば、document.getElementByIdinnerHTMLを使って、特定の要素に年を挿入する方法が一般的です。これにより、手動での更新作業が不要になり、毎年の更新忘れを防ぐことができます。ただし、JavaScriptが無効な環境では動作しないため、その点には注意が必要です。また、SEO対策やアクセシビリティの観点から、初期状態で適切な年が表示されているかどうかも確認しておくことが重要です。

さらに、フレームワークやライブラリを活用することで、より柔軟な実装が可能になります。例えば、ReactやVue.jsなどのモダンなフレームワークを使用すれば、コンポーネント単位でコピーライト表示を管理し、再利用性を高めることができます。これにより、大規模なウェブサイトでも効率的に運用できるようになります。

サーバーサイド言語を使った自動反映方法

サーバーサイド言語を使用してコピーライトの更新年を自動反映する方法は、効率的で信頼性の高いソリューションとして広く利用されています。サーバーサイド言語には、PHPやPython、Rubyなどが挙げられますが、いずれも現在の年を取得し、それを動的にウェブページに反映させることが可能です。例えば、PHPを使用する場合、date("Y")関数を使って現在の年を取得し、それをHTMLに埋め込むことができます。これにより、毎年手動で更新する手間が省け、人的ミスを防ぐことができます。

サーバーサイドでの自動反映は、クライアントサイドのJavaScriptに依存しないため、ユーザーのブラウザ設定やJavaScriptの無効化に影響されません。これは、特に情報セキュリティーが重要なサイトや、広範なユーザー層を対象とするサイトにとって大きなメリットです。さらに、サーバーサイド言語はキャッシュ機構と組み合わせることで、パフォーマンスの最適化も図れます。これにより、ページの読み込み速度を維持しながら、常に最新の情報を提供することが可能です。

また、サーバーサイドでの自動化は、大規模なウェブサイト複数のページを持つサイトにおいて特に効果的です。例えば、eコマースサイトやニュースポータルなど、頻繁にコンテンツが更新されるサイトでは、コピーライトの更新年を手動で管理するのは現実的ではありません。サーバーサイド言語を活用することで、一元的な管理が可能となり、サイト全体の品質を維持しやすくなります。将来的には、AIやクラウドサービスとの連携により、さらに高度な自動化が実現されることが期待されています。

自動反映のメリット

自動反映の最大のメリットは、手作業による更新の手間を大幅に削減できる点です。従来、コピーライトの更新年を手動で変更する場合、管理者は毎年ファイルを開き、年数を書き換える必要がありました。しかし、JavaScriptサーバーサイド言語を活用することで、このプロセスを自動化できます。これにより、管理者は他の重要なタスクに集中できるようになり、業務効率の向上が期待できます。

さらに、自動反映を導入することで、人的ミスのリスクを軽減できます。手動での更新では、年数の書き間違いや更新漏れが発生する可能性がありますが、自動化により、常に正確な年数が表示されるようになります。特に、複数のページや大規模なウェブサイトを管理している場合、このメリットは顕著です。

また、情報セキュリティーの向上も見逃せないポイントです。手動での更新では、ファイルを頻繁に編集する必要があるため、誤って重要な設定を変更してしまうリスクがあります。自動反映を利用すれば、ファイルの編集頻度を減らすことができ、セキュリティーリスクの低減につながります。これにより、ウェブサイトの信頼性が高まり、ユーザーからの信頼も得やすくなります。

実例紹介:大手企業やeコマースサイト

大手企業eコマースサイトでは、コピーライトの更新年を自動的に反映させる仕組みが広く採用されています。例えば、ある大手ECサイトでは、JavaScriptを使用してフロントエンドで現在の年を取得し、コピーライト表示を動的に更新しています。これにより、毎年手動で更新する手間が省け、人的ミスを防ぐことが可能になりました。また、サーバーサイド言語を活用して、サイト全体のコピーライト年を一括管理している企業もあります。これにより、複数のページやドメインにまたがるコピーライト表示を効率的に更新できるようになりました。

さらに、クラウドサービスと連携して、コピーライト年を自動的に同期する仕組みを導入している事例もあります。例えば、ある企業では、AWS Lambdaを使用して、定期的にコピーライト年を更新するスクリプトを実行しています。これにより、情報セキュリティーの向上とともに、運用コストの削減も実現しています。これらの実例からもわかるように、コピーライト年の自動反映は、効率化品質向上に大きく貢献しています。

将来的には、AIを活用したさらなる自動化が期待されています。例えば、AIがサイトの更新状況を監視し、必要に応じてコピーライト年を自動的に調整する仕組みが考えられます。これにより、管理者の負担がさらに軽減され、より高度な自動化が実現するでしょう。

今後の展望:AIやクラウドサービスの活用

ウェブサイトのコピーライト更新年を自動化する技術は、今後さらに進化していくことが予想されます。特に、AIクラウドサービスの活用によって、より高度な自動化が実現されるでしょう。AIを活用することで、コピーライトの更新だけでなく、コンテンツの最適化やユーザー行動の分析も自動的に行えるようになる可能性があります。これにより、ウェブサイト全体の品質向上と運用効率のさらなる向上が期待できます。

また、クラウドサービスとの統合によって、複数のウェブサイトやプラットフォーム間でのコピーライト情報の同期が容易になります。これにより、大規模なウェブサイト運営においても、一元的な管理が可能となり、人的ミスを大幅に削減できるでしょう。さらに、クラウドベースの自動化ツールは、リアルタイムでの更新や監視を可能にし、情報セキュリティーの強化にも寄与します。

今後の技術進化に伴い、コピーライト更新の自動化は、単なる時間節約の手段から、ウェブサイト運営全体の効率化と品質向上を支える重要な要素となるでしょう。AIクラウドサービスのさらなる発展に注目しながら、これらの技術を積極的に取り入れることが、今後ますます重要になっていくと考えられます。

まとめ

ウェブサイトのコピーライト更新年を手動で変更する作業は、管理者にとって時間と労力がかかる課題です。特に、複数のページを持つ大規模なサイトでは、更新漏れやミスが発生しやすくなります。この問題を解決するために、JavaScriptサーバーサイド言語を活用して、コピーライトの更新年を自動的に反映する方法が注目されています。

JavaScriptを使用する場合、クライアントサイドで現在の年を取得し、動的にコピーライト表示を更新することが可能です。これにより、管理者が手動で年を変更する必要がなくなり、作業効率が大幅に向上します。一方、サーバーサイド言語(例:PHP、Python、Rubyなど)を利用する方法では、ページが生成される際に自動的に最新の年を反映させることができます。このアプローチは、クライアントサイドの処理に依存しないため、より安定した運用が可能です。

これらの自動化手法を導入することで、時間的コストの削減人的ミスの軽減が実現されます。さらに、常に最新の情報が表示されるため、ユーザーに対する信頼性も向上します。特に、大手企業eコマースサイトでは、このような自動化が既に広く採用されており、効果を実証しています。

将来的には、AIクラウドサービスとの統合により、さらに高度な自動化が期待されています。例えば、AIがコピーライトの更新タイミングを予測したり、クラウドベースの管理ツールが一元的に更新を処理したりする可能性があります。これにより、ウェブサイト運営の効率化がさらに進むでしょう。

よくある質問

1. コピーライト更新年を自動反映するメリットは何ですか?

コピーライト更新年を自動反映する最大のメリットは、手動での更新作業が不要になることです。毎年手動で年を変更する手間が省け、ヒューマンエラーのリスクも軽減されます。さらに、最新の年が常に表示されるため、ユーザーに対して正確な情報を提供できます。特に複数のページやサイトを管理している場合、効率性が大幅に向上します。

2. JavaScriptでコピーライト年を自動更新する方法は?

JavaScriptを使用してコピーライト年を自動更新するには、Dateオブジェクトを活用します。例えば、以下のようなコードを使用します:
javascript
document.getElementById("copyright-year").innerText = new Date().getFullYear();

このコードは、現在の年を取得し、指定された要素に自動的に反映します。サーバーサイドの処理が不要で、クライアント側で簡単に実装できるため、開発コストが低く抑えられる点が特徴です。

3. サーバーサイドでコピーライト年を自動更新する場合の注意点は?

サーバーサイドでコピーライト年を自動更新する場合、サーバーのタイムゾーン設定に注意が必要です。サーバーのタイムゾーンが異なる場合、誤った年が表示される可能性があります。また、キャッシュの影響を受けることもあるため、適切なキャッシュ管理が重要です。さらに、パフォーマンスへの影響を考慮し、不要な処理を避けることが推奨されます。

4. コピーライト年を自動更新する際のベストプラクティスは?

コピーライト年を自動更新する際のベストプラクティスは、JavaScriptとサーバーサイドのどちらを使用するかを適切に判断することです。JavaScriptはクライアント側で簡単に実装できますが、JavaScriptが無効な環境では機能しません。一方、サーバーサイドは信頼性が高いものの、開発コストが高くなる場合があります。また、年が変わるタイミング(例:年末年始)での動作確認を徹底し、クロスブラウザ対応モバイルデバイスでの表示も考慮することが重要です。

関連ブログ記事 :  「CSS linear-gradient()完全ガイド:グラデーション作成とデザインテクニック」

関連ブログ記事

コメントを残す

Go up